Rockwell Falls

Tied by: Larry Leight
Originated by: Larry Leight
Rockwell Falls Streamer Fly Pattern Recipe
Hook: Gaelic Supreme Mike Martinek Rangeley Streamer hook #1 10xl
Thread: Black 8/0
Tag: Copper flat tinsel
Tail: Purple hackle fibers
Body: Peacock mylar mylar
Rib: Gold oval tinsel
Belly: Peacock herl, dark blue then purple then black bucktail (sparse)
Throat: Silver pheasant crest, then purple hackle fibers the Silver Dr. blue hackle fibers
Wing: Black hackle flanked by brown dun hackle flanked by kingfisher blue hackle flanked by purple Coq de Leon hackle
Eye: Jungle cock nail
Head: Black
Notes:
Rockwell Falls can be found on the upper Hudson River as it flows through the town of Lake Lucerne. The colors for the Rockwell Falls streamer were inspired by his wife's betta fish.Sections:
